> Ghuoargh schrieb:
> > A few days ago I have downloaded Cygwin from cygwin.com and installed it
> > on my computer.
> > However, since then some other programs did not function properly any
> > more and it may be that Cygwin is responsible for this.
> > Therefore I want to uninstall Cygwin.
> > I read on the pages of cygwin.com, that in order to do this I need to
> > enter the command "umount" (several times) somewhere and uninstall by
> > this procedure all mount points which are listed when I enter "mount"
> > alone (this procedure is correct, or?).
>
> Please read
> http://cygwin.com/faq/faq.setup.html#faq.setup.uninstall-all
>
> mount points are just registry entries which do no harm to other
> programs and are deleted by step 6 of the FAQ entry.
